Do you hypotenuse of a triangle is 1 foot more than twice the length of the shorter leg the longer leg is 7 feet longer than the
Lera25 [3.4K]

Answer:

Shorter leg: 8 units

Longer leg: 15 units

Hypotenuse: 17 units

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given h=1+2s where h is the hypotenuse and s is the length of the shorter leg.

We got this equation from reading that the "hypotenuse of a triangle is 1 foot more than twice the length of the shorter leg". I replaced the "hypotenuse of a triangle" with h, "is" with =, "1 foot more than" with 1+ and finally "twice the length of the shorter leg" with 2s.

We also have "longer leg is 7 feet longer than the shorter leg".

I'm going to replace "longer leg" with L.

I'm going to replace "is" with =.

I'm going to replace "7 feet longer than the shorter leg" with 7+s.

So we have the equation L=7+s.

So we have a right triangle since something there is a side being referred to as the hypotenuse. We can use Pythagorean Theorem to find a relation between all these sides.

So by Pythagorean Theorem, we have: s^2+L^2=h^2.

Let's make some substitutions from above:

s^2+(7+s)^2=(1+2s)^2

Let's expand the powers using:

(a+b)^2=a^2+2ab+b^2

Applying this now:

s^2+(49+2(7)s+s^2)=(1+2(1)(2s)+(2s)^2)

s^2+49+14s+s^2=1+4s+4s^2

Combine like terms on right hand side:

2s^2+49+14s=1+4s+4s^2

Subtract everything on left hand side to get 0 on that side:

0=(1-49)+(4s-14s)+(4s^2-2s^2)

Simplify:

0=(-48)+(-10s)+(2s^2)

Reorder into standard form for a quadratic:

0=2s^2-10s-48

Every term is even and therefore divisible by 2. I will divide both sides by 2:

0=s^2-5s-24

I'm going to see if this is factoroable.

We need to see if we can come up with two numbers that multiply -24 and add up to be -5.

Those numbers are -8 and 3.

So the factored form is:

0=(s-8)(s+3)

This implies that either s-8=0 os s+3=0.

The first equation can be solved by adding 8 on both sides: s=8.

The second equation can be solved by subtracting 3 on both sides: s=-3.

The only solution that makes sense for s is 8 since it can't the shorter length cannot be a negative number.

s=8

L=7+s=7+8=15

h=1+2s=1+2(8)=1+16=17

So the dimensions of the right triangle are:

Shorter leg: 8 units

Longer leg: 15 units

Hypotenuse: 17 units
